About Nirupam Dutta
Nirupam Dutta is a seasoned Analog and Mixed-Signal Circuit Design Engineer with around a decade of experience in developing high-performance analog and mixed-signal integrated circuits. Over the years, he has built a strong portfolio of work across a wide spectrum of circuit blocks, including operational amplifiers (OPAMPs), bandgap reference circuits, phase-locked loops (PLLs), delay-locked loops (DLLs), time-to-digital converters (TDCs), and digital-to-analog converters (DACs). Nirupam\'s in-depth understanding of analog design principles, combined with hands-on experience across multiple technology nodes, has allowed him to deliver robust, low-power, and high-precision solutions for complex system-on-chip (SoC) designs.Currently, Nirupam is contributing to the development of high-speed PLLs operating up to 28 GHz for advanced SerDes applications. His responsibilities include the design and optimization of critical PLL sub-blocks such as voltage regulators, charge pumps, VCOs, and output clock drivers. With experience in both LC-based and ring-based PLL architectures, he ensures optimal trade-offs between jitter performance, power efficiency, and silicon area. Additionally, his background includes working on both transmitter (Tx) and receiver (Rx) front-end circuits, making him a well-rounded contributor in high-speed analog and mixed-signal system design.
